>> > When trying to manipulate files for which I have group write >> > permissions but not user write permissions, the operation fails (such >> > as move or delete). If the directory those files are in does not have group write permissions as well, it must fail. > I am not the owner of the file. I am only a member of the group. What's strange is that if the permissions for dir and file are OK, Geeqie will complain it can't copy (!) or move the file, but will do it anyway! Same applies to scripts ("External Editors").
